Simon Bailes Peugeot Northallerton is seeking a motivated and enthusiastic individual to join as a Service Advisor Apprentice. This apprenticeship provides a structured route into the automotive service industry, combining paid employment with nationally recognised Level 2 training.
40 hours per week, typically Monday to Friday. Normal working hours: 8:30am - 5:30pm, although this may vary depending on the dealership. Approximately 20% of your working week will be dedicated to Off-the-Job learning, delivered via online classrooms, face-to-face sessions, and block release training at The Performance Academy, Coventry.
Apprentices are employed directly by Simon Bailes dealership. Training includes week-long block release, requiring travel and overnight stays away from home at The Performance Academy, Coventry. Supported through:
All training aligns with IMI/ESFA standards, providing nationally recognised qualifications and practical skills to succeed.
Level 2 Customer Service Practitioner Apprenticeship (IMI)
Pay is set by the employing Simon Bailes dealership. All apprentices are paid at least the Apprenticeship Minimum Wage, with opportunities for progression as skills develop.
